Embodiment Construction

[0019] refer to figure 1 and figure 2 , a more easily donned compressible composite elastic stocking is divided into two parts 11, 12 in the first embodiment.

[0020] The first part 11 is adapted to cover the foot and the lower part of the tibia, and the second part 12 is adapted to cover the rest of the tibia to close to the knee.

[0021] Each part 11 , 12 has an end 13 , 14 facing each other, which has approximately half the compression force of the sock-forming parts 11 , 12 . These less compressive ends 13, 14 are intended to be folded on top of each other in order to obtain the desired degree of sock compression. This recreates a calibrated compression and there is still a breakout to facilitate wearing the stocking and inserting it under.

Abstract

A compressive composite elastic stocking which is easier to put on comprising at least two parts (11, 12; 111, 112) suitable for realising, when applied to a leg, a stocking in a single piece with a predetermined degree of compression.

Description

field of invention [0001] The present invention relates to an improved compressible composite elastic stocking. [0002] It should be noted that the term "sock" refers to socks such as stockings, tights, socks etc. with a closed toe or open toe. [0003] In addition, the term "elastic" hosiery refers to the above hosiery with varying degrees of compression, such as the presence of more or less elastomeric threads and / or natural rubber with cotton, polyamide, polyester or other types of determined by the combination of fibers. Background technique [0004] In fact, this type of elastic stockings is especially used in the treatment of varicose veins, insufficiency of veins, thrombophlebitis and problems related to venous diseases. [0005] This type of sock is primarily used by patients of a certain age who may have difficulty wearing the sock on their leg or certain parts of the leg.
